www.dell.com | support.dell.com Parameters Defaults Command Modes Command History Usage Information Related Commands To delete the authentication failure VLAN, use the no dot1x auth-fail-vlan vlan-id [max-attempts number] command. vlan-id max-attempts number Enter the VLAN Identifier. Range: 1 to 4094 (OPTIONAL) Enter the keyword max-attempts followed number of attempts desired before authentication fails. Range: 1 to 5 Default: 3 3 attempts CONFIGURATION (conf-if-interface-slot/port) Version 8.3.19.0 Version 8.3.7.0 Version 7.6.1.0 Introduced on S4820T Introduced on S4810 Introduced on C-Series, E-Series and S-Series If the host responds to 802.1X with an incorrect login/password, the login fails. The switch will attempt to authenticate again until the maximum attempts configured is reached. If the authentication fails after all allowed attempts, the interface is moved to the authentication failed VLAN. Once the authentication VLAN is assigned, the port-state must be toggled to restart authentication.
